LEDA / PGC 22524 is a spiral galaxy of the Hubble type Sc in the constellation Giraffe in the northern sky . It is an estimated 75 million light years from the Milky Way and about 20,000 light years across. Together with NGC 2460 , IC 2209 , PGC 22508 and PGC 22561 , it forms the small NGC 2460 group .
